About this route:
A direct, nonstop flight between Aswan International Airport (ASW), Aswan, Egypt and Oxnard Airport (OXR), Oxnard, California, United States would travel a Great Circle distance of 8,018 miles (or 12,904 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Aswan International Airport and Oxnard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Aswan International Airport (ASW):
- The furthest airport from Aswan International Airport (ASW) is Rurutu Airport (RUR), which is nearly antipodal to Aswan International Airport (meaning Aswan International Airport is almost on the exact opposite side of the Earth from Rurutu Airport), and is located 12,151 miles (19,555 kilometers) away in Rurutu, French Polynesia.
- The closest airport to Aswan International Airport (ASW) is Luxor International Airport (LXR), which is located 118 miles (190 kilometers) N of ASW.
- In addition to being known as "Aswan International Airport", other names for ASW include "مطار أسوان الدولي" and "Daraw Airport".
- Because of Aswan International Airport's relatively low elevation of 662 feet, planes can take off or land at Aswan International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Aswan International Airport (ASW) currently has only 1 runway.
Facts about Oxnard Airport (OXR):
- The closest airport to Oxnard Airport (OXR) is Naval Air Station Point Mugu (NTD), which is located only 7 miles (12 kilometers) SE of OXR.
- The furthest airport from Oxnard Airport (OXR) is Pierrefonds Airport (ZSE), which is located 11,489 miles (18,489 kilometers) away in Saint-Pierre, Réunion.
- Ventura County opened Oxnard Airport in 1934 by clearing a 3,500 ft dirt runway.
- Oxnard Airport (OXR) currently has only 1 runway.
- In addition to being known as "Oxnard Airport", another name for OXR is "Ventura County Army Airfield".
- Because of Oxnard Airport's relatively low elevation of 45 feet, planes can take off or land at Oxnard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
